Degree of fluency in Spanish of students on admission to the bachelor's degree and its association with school performance and efficiency terminal

Abstract
This article explores the relationship between the scores of Spanish -specifically the component of grammar and writing- obtained through the application of the diagnostic test at the beginning of the Higher Education with school performance over the first two years and at the end of the bachelor's degree (curriculum time) of the generation 2010 at the Universidad Nacional Autónoma de México (UNAM). To test this association a multivariate logistic regression model is applied. The results revealed that the higher the score in grammar and writing, the better school performance during the bachelor's degree and also greater terminal efficiency.
